Gabriel Syveton was a French historian and politician.

2.

Gabriel Syveton was one of the founding members of the patriotic and anti-Dreyfus Ligue de la patrie francaise.

3.

Gabriel Syveton was elected as deputy for the Seine in 1902.

4.

Gabriel Syveton exposed the existence of a card file compiled from Freemason reports on public officials.

5.

Gabriel Syveton was found dead the day before being required to appear in court after slapping the Minister of War in the Chamber of Deputies.

6.

Gabriel Syveton was born on 21 February 1864 in Boen-sur-Lignon, Loire.

7.

Gabriel Syveton studied in Lyon and then in Paris, and passed his agregation in history in 1888 as a doctor of letters and associate professor.

8.

Gabriel Syveton taught in turn at the lycees of Aix-en-Provence, Laon, Angouleme and Reims.
